What is the average salary in Mission, TX?

The average salary in Mission, TX is $42,673 per year.

What are the best paying jobs in Mission, TX?

Job seekers in Mission, TX, have several rewarding career paths to explore. Registered Nurses earn the highest salaries in the area, with an average salary of about $103,439 per year. This profession involves providing care to patients and working with doctors and other healthcare professionals. Other well-paying jobs in Mission include Insurance Agents, with an average salary of around $57,097 annually. This role involves helping clients understand and purchase insurance policies. Retail Sales Associates and Medical Assistants also offer competitive wages, with salaries averaging about $50,046 and $27,221, respectively. How does the cost of living in Mission, TX compare to the national average?

The cost of living index in Mission, TX, stands at 89, slightly below the nationwide average of 100. This means residents of Mission experience a cost of living that is 11% lower than the national norm. Specifically, lower housing, utilities, and transportation costs contribute to this affordability, making Mission a more budget-friendly option for many. Cost of living comparison graph for Mission, TX vs. Nationwide: housing 16% lower, groceries 5% lower, utilities 8% lower, transportation 13% lower, healthcare 10% lower, miscellaneous 12% lower.

Mission, TX, has a cost of living that stands slightly below the nationwide average. The housing index in Mission is 84, which means it costs 16% less than the national average. This lower housing cost can make Mission an attractive option for those seeking more affordable living arrangements.


Across various sectors, Mission shows similar trends. Groceries cost 95 compared to the average of 100, which means they are nearly at the national norm. Utilities in Mission are priced at 92, 8% below the average. Transportation costs are also slightly lower, with an index of 87, making it 13% cheaper than the national average. Healthcare expenses in Mission are at 90, only 10% below the average. Miscellaneous costs, which include items like entertainment and personal care, are at 88, also 12% below the average. These figures suggest that Mission offers some cost savings compared to the nationwide average across most categories.
